This 3-sentence summary provides the essential information about the document: The document is an abstract for a paper presented at the IEEE International Performance Computing and Communications Conference in December 2017 in San Diego, CA. The paper proposes an unsupervised machine learning algorithm to determine the locations of fog nodes in 5G heterogeneous networks in order to reduce latency through soft clustering, where low power nodes can probabilistically connect to multiple fog nodes.
